I invite you to clench a fist and then open your hand again. You have just experienced contraction and expansion – tension and (rel)ease on a physical level.

On the physical layer the principle is quite easy to understand: You can contract and relax your muscles. A fist represents contraction. An open hand stands for relaxation.
The same principle applies to all kinds of layers within yourself. Let's have a look!
On the mental layer we can identify perspectives that are more contracted (tunnel-vision) and others that are more open (bird’s-eye-view). An example: The believe that »I have to solve every problem in my life alone without any help« versus the believe that »I do have all the help that I need and that life is always for me.« Which of the two beliefs is more contracted and which one is more open? You get the idea.
On the emotional layer we can identify feelings that are more contracted – for example anger – and feelings that are more expansive and light – for example joy.
On the energetic layer the same principle applies. Energy centers (chakras) can be blocked and the energy stuck and they can be open and the energy flowing.

All the layers I describe above are connected to one another – interdependent. You can have the thought »I’m not good enough« and it might create sadness (emotional layer) in your system and make your body feel heavy (physical level).
